Sarkodie yellow-carded
Akron junior defender Kofi Sarkodie received a yellow card in the 41st minute for knocking down Michigan's freshman midfielder Fabio Pereira. The College Cup match was tied 1-1 at the time.
Sarkodie scored three goals in Akron's 7-1 victory over Michigan on Oct. 19.
